site stats

K-means clustering on iris dataset python

WebKmeans clustering on Iris dataset. K-means clustering is one of the simplest unsupervised machine learning algorithms. We are given a data set of items, with certain features, and values for these features (like a … Webk-means clustering is a method of vector quantization, originally from signal processing, that aims to partition n observations into k clusters in which each observation belongs to the cluster with the nearest mean (cluster …

Implementation of Hierarchical Clustering using Python - Hands …

WebApr 10, 2024 · In this blog post I have endeavoured to cluster the iris dataset using sklearn’s KMeans clustering algorithm. KMeans is a clustering algorithm in scikit-learn that partitions a set of data ... WebKMeans is an Unsupervised Machine Learning Algorithm used to cluster datasets with no labels.This is s short video on how to apply Kmeans algorithm on IRIS ... greyhound milton malsor https://stankoga.com

K-Means Clustering From Scratch in Python [Algorithm Explained]

WebMar 27,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ebK means works through the following iterative process: Pick a value for k (the number of clusters to create) Initialize k ‘centroids’ (starting points) in your data Create your clusters.... fiduciary investment advisors hawaii

sklearn.cluster.KMeans — scikit-learn 1.2.2 documentation

Category:Analyzing Decision Tree and K-means Clustering using Iris dataset

Tags:K-means clustering on iris dataset python

K-means clustering on iris dataset python

Clustering by k-means method with MLlib of Spark - sambaiz-net

Web2 days ago · Here is a step-by-step approach to evaluating an image classification model on an Imbalanced dataset: Split the dataset into training and test sets. It is important to use stratified sampling to ensure that each class is represented in both the training and test sets. Train the image classification model on the training set. WebThe k-means problem is solved using either Lloyd’s or Elkan’s algorithm. The average complexity is given by O (k n T), where n is the number of samples and T is the number of …

K-means clustering on iris dataset python

Did you know?

WebSimple K-means clustering on the Iris dataset. In [1]: #importing the libraries import numpy as np import matplotlib.pyplot as plt import pandas as pd #importing the Iris dataset with … Web4. KMedoids Clustering and Agglomerative Clustering: 1. Write a Python program to find clusters of Iris Dataset using KMedoids Clustering Algorithm. # !pip install scikit-learn-extra: from sklearn.datasets import load_iris: from sklearn.preprocessing import StandardScaler: from sklearn_extra.cluster import KMedoids: from sklearn import metrics

WebOct 24, 2024 · 1. Medoid Initialization. To start the algorithm, we need an initial guess. Let’s randomly choose 𝑘 observations from the data. In this case, 𝑘 = 3, representing 3 different types of iris. Next, we will create a function, init_medoids (X, k), so that it randomly selects 𝑘 of the given observations to serve as medoids. WebJan 24, 2024 · KMeans is a method for clustering (unsupervised learning), therefore it will build cluster and not predict classes. As someone else already indicated the effect is that …

WebMay 27, 2024 · The K that will return the highest positive value for the Silhouette Coefficient should be selected. When to use which of these two clustering techniques, depends on … WebK-means Clustering ¶. K-means Clustering. ¶. The plot shows: top left: What a K-means algorithm would yield using 8 clusters. top right: What the effect of a bad initialization is on the classification process: By setting n_init to only 1 (default is 10), the amount of times that the algorithm will be run with different centroid seeds is ...

WebK Means clustering algorithm is unsupervised machine learning technique used to cluster data points. In this tutorial we will go over some theory …

WebApr 26, 2024 · Here are the steps to follow in order to find the optimal number of clusters using the elbow method: Step 1: Execute the K-means clustering on a given dataset for … greyhound midland texasWebAug 31, 2024 · In practice, we use the following steps to perform K-means clustering: 1. Choose a value for K. First, we must decide how many clusters we’d like to identify in the data. Often we have to simply test several different values for K and analyze the results to see which number of clusters seems to make the most sense for a given problem. fiduciary investment advisors mergerWebScikit Learn - KMeans Clustering Analysis with the Iris Data Set greyhound milwaukee airportWebNew Dataset. emoji_events. New Competition. call_split. Copy & edit notebook. history. View versions. content_paste. Copy API command. open_in_new. ... Iris Exploration (PCA, k-Means and GMM clustering) Python · Iris Species. Iris Exploration (PCA, k-Means and GMM clustering) Notebook. Input. Output. Logs. Comments (5) Run. 937.9s. history ... fiduciary investmentWebJan 24, 2024 · As well as it is common to use the iris data because it is quite easy to build a perfect classification model (supervised) but it is a totally different story when it comes to clustering (unsupervised). If you look at your KMeans results keep in mind that KMeans always builds convex clusters regarding the used norm/metric. Share. greyhound milton malsor menuWebApr 10, 2024 · K-Means Clustering in Python: A Beginner’s Guide. ... This allows us to see how well the GMM model performed in clustering the iris dataset. The output of the above print statement is shown below: ARI: 0.90. The resulting ARI score should be close to 1, indicating that the GMM clustering has accurately predicted the class labels. ... fiduciary investment trust balanced bWebApr 13, 2024 · K-means clustering is a popular technique for finding groups of similar data points in a multidimensional space. It works by assigning each point to one of K clusters, based on the distance to the ... greyhound milwaukee